  <em>He alone is my rock and my salvation, my stronghold; I will not be shaken. -Psalm 62:6 (HCSB)</em>
</p></blockquote>
<p>Recently, the regular staff I&#8217;d listen to on a local Christian music station abruptly changed. The people who I&#8217;d listen to and not even think twice about disappearing were now gone. They were replaced by new staff, who were nice in their own right, but were <em>different</em>.</p>
<p>And recently, many cherished friends and coworkers (many who were fellow true believers) either went on to other jobs, or were dismissed. It left gaping holes for all of us, putting a beam of light on the giant question marks ahead in the road.</p>
<p>And, of course, we have loved ones who have passed&#8230;people we&#8217;ve known our entire lives. And they, too, leave holes in our hearts and minds.</p>
<p>The common theme here is the discomfort of change. We like comfort, especially with those with whom we can build each other up and enjoy this walk in life. And sometimes change makes us very uncomfortable.</p>
<p>But, because our Father knows best for all of us, we can trust that His plans for those who&#8217;ve moved on are good, just as His plans for us left behind are also good. He weaves an amazing tapestry with the threads of our lives. There&#8217;s no saying our threads won&#8217;t come together again, in amazing and unexpected ways according to His design.</p>
<p>The constant of this world is change. But our higher constant to always hold onto is our Father, and His promises. We hold fast to them, and can weather any storm through Him.   <em>You have decided the length of our lives. You know how many months we will live, and we are not given a minute longer. -Job 14:5 (NLT)</em>
</p></blockquote>
<p>Twenty years ago, around Easter of 1995, I was driving down the freeway one night on the way home, about 65 mph (104.6 kph). The freeway was empty, except for an SUV parked on the shoulder&#8230;and a man standing outside of it in the shadows.</p>
<p>As I approached the SUV, I noticed the man made a throwing motion. Next thing I knew, something had crashed through my windshield and would smash me in the face. In that instant, I turned my head slightly to the right, and the object smashed my left jaw. Glass and blood were everywhere&#8230;in my mouth, eyelashes, and all over the interior of the car.</p>
<p>I rolled down the car window and blasted the radio to keep myself from blacking out, and managed to eventually drive home and recover. The object was a large chunk of concrete, which probably would&#8217;ve killed me if I hadn&#8217;t turned my head.</p>
<p>A few months later in the same year, <a href="http://agentsoflight.org/treat-your-body-right/">I was sideswiped</a> when I was about to get out of my car, which had overheated on the freeway. My car was totaled, and to this day, my knee has never been the same.</p>
<p>Twenty years later, in December 2015, I was visiting family in the hospital, but security stopped me and other visitors from leaving the lobby to get to our cars. It turns out that someone was shooting people in the back of the hospital, so no one could come in or out. A few minutes later, security did let a few of us go to our cars, so I headed home.</p>
<p>Some would say that I am really lucky, or cheated death, or avoided death, but as believers, we know we have nothing to do with determining our time of death. And we also know that there is no such thing as luck.</p>
<p>God knows exactly when it&#8217;s our time to go. We don&#8217;t ever need to worry about how and when we will leave this earth, but instead take comfort in knowing that He does, and that if we believe in His Son and His saving work for us on the cross, that we will pass on from this world into the eternal ecstasy of His presence.</p>

<blockquote><p><em>The righteous cry out, and the Lord hears them; he delivers them from all their troubles. The Lord is close to the brokenhearted and saves those who are crushed in spirit. -Psalm 34:17-18</em></p></blockquote>
<p>There’s a reason why the theme of so much devotional writing is comfort: We live in a fallen world, and the sin nature in ourselves and others can make life very difficult…and sometimes just too much to bear.</p>
<p>…at least on our own. Consider the following:</p>
<blockquote><p>At first Peter didn&#8217;t consider the wind and the waves at all; he simply recognized his Lord, stepped out, and &#8216;walked on the water.&#8217; Then he began to take those things around him into account, and instantly, down he went. The things surrounding you are real, but when you look at them you are immediately overwhelmed. Let your actual circumstances be what they may, but keep recognizing Jesus, maintaining complete reliance upon Him. -Oswald Chambers, from <em>My Utmost for His Highest</em>.</p></blockquote>
<p>There is a reality greater than what you can touch and see and feel&#8230;the <a href="http://agentsoflight.org/faith-expands-and-enriches-awareness/">layers of spiritual richness</a> we can easily see when things are going well. But when the going gets tough, how quickly we can forget it, losing touch with our spiritual senses. We’re back to just our flesh senses, and they can lie and deceive us relentlessly, pulling us into a downward spiral of self-pity, condemnation, doubt, and despair.</p>
<p>When you hit that slippery slope, you’re looking ever more at yourself. And the enemy is whispering in your ear that you are doing the right thing.</p>
<p>There are two things happening here: The harsh reality of your situation, and the perceived reality through your senses. And as rocky and blustery as it all is, the Lord is your footing beneath it all. He shines down on you with His sun, and cleanses you with His rain. And through it all, He whispers to you, if you listen: <strong>Trust Me, I will carry you through this, as I have so many times before.</strong></p>
<p>Remember what the Lord had Joshua tell the Israelites before they entered the Promised Land:</p>
<blockquote><p><em>The Lord himself goes before you and will be with you; he will never leave you nor forsake you. Do not be afraid; do not be discouraged. -Deuteronomy 31:8</em></p></blockquote>
